Output 995767060c21fc6f8ecb5a50de7d119fa287afe1eaec0a1f91ae64e1af6c57da:2

value
3241325
script pubkey
OP_0 OP_PUSHBYTES_32 ec0e7ef79692b483c4124e80ee075b4885c9c1b7262d07f296d7f64917e4c1cb
address
bc1qas88aaukj26g83qjf6qwup6mfzzunsdhycks0u5k6lmyj9lyc89shrl3dw
transaction
995767060c21fc6f8ecb5a50de7d119fa287afe1eaec0a1f91ae64e1af6c57da
spent
true